Small farms and CSAs struggle to forecast member demand and allocate harvest between shares and markets; an AI forecasting and planning tool predicts demand, recommends allocations, and optimizes pricing and distribution to reduce waste and increase revenue.
Many CSA operators, small market farms and food hubs struggle to match weekly share orders to highly variable short-term yields, which causes wasted produce, refunds and unpredictable revenue; this pain is experienced across an estimated 1,000,000 direct-market sellers. These operators generally lack forecasting expertise and the time to translate weather, phenology and sales signals into reliable allocation decisions. You could build an AI-driven forecasting and allocation SaaS that ingests weather, satellite and phenology APIs plus POS/ordering data to predict near-term yields and generate harvest and packing allocations by share type. The product would prioritize turnkey integrations, simple dashboards and automated allocation rules so operators can act quickly without becoming data scientists. The addressable market is roughly $1.2B (1,000,000 sellers × $1,200 ACV) and is attractive right now because interest in local food is rising and small-farm digitization creates clear integration points (market score 86/100, revenue potential 80/100). A defensible edge is combining higher-accuracy short-term yield models (satellite + phenology + weather) with action-oriented allocation recommendations that reduce waste and missed shares, but success will depend on nailing onboarding and reliability across highly heterogeneous small farms.
AI time-series and causal models are mature enough to forecast short-range demand with limited historical data, and weather/remote-sensing APIs are inexpensive and widely available. At the same time, consumer interest in local food and waste reduction is rising, and more small farms use digital POS/market tools, creating the integrations needed for fast adoption. Cloud infrastructure and AI APIs lower build cost, making an MVP achievable quickly.
